DE as Coach

“If an author doesn’t know how to write, there’s nothing that an editor can do to help.” I’ve heard this opinion expressed by colleagues whose editorial judgment I deeply respect. It is true that a manuscript aspiring to literary heights cannot be lifted there by editing. But most authors of nonfiction wish only to communicate clearly, and an editor can certainly help a willing author to improve those skills. The DE is the author’s public speaking coach; her podium, the printed page.
